Understanding the Mechanics: Why Fabric Changes Everything
The fundamental principle behind garden grow bags is their promotion of "air pruning." Unlike traditional in-ground planting or hard-sided pots, where roots circle the interior seeking an escape, the porous fabric of these bags allows air to reach the root tips. When a root encounters this air, it naturally dries out and stops growing, prompting the development of new, fibrous roots. This results in a dense, healthy root system that resembles a finely tuned net, rather than a tangled, circling mess. This air-pruning effect is the single most significant factor contributing to the vigorous growth often observed in bag gardens, leading to stronger plants with greater resilience to disease and pests.
Enhanced Drainage and Aeration
Water management is often the most challenging aspect of gardening, and grow bags solve this with elegance. The fabric material allows water to flow through freely, preventing the dangerous stagnation that leads to root rot. Excess moisture evaporates through the sides, ensuring the growing medium remains at an ideal, consistent level of moisture. Simultaneously, the ample airflow through the bag's sides ensures that roots receive the oxygen they need to thrive. This combination of perfect drainage and aeration creates an environment that is exceptionally difficult to replicate in standard pots or garden beds, making grow bags particularly beneficial for moisture-sensitive plants or in climates with high humidity.

Portability and Space Optimization
One of the most celebrated features of grow bags is their mobility. Filled with soil and plants, they are still lightweight enough to be repositioned with ease. This allows you to chase the sun as the seasons change, placing your tomatoes on the sunniest patio spot in summer and moving them to a sheltered corner for winter. Furthermore, their unique shape—conforming to the contours of a balcony wall or fitting neatly into a corner—maximizes the use of vertical and irregular spaces. This transforms previously unusable areas into productive garden zones, democratizing gardening for urban and suburban dwellers alike.
Material, Durability, and Environmental Impact
Modern garden grow bags are typically constructed from thick, non-woven polypropylene fabric. This material is selected for its durability, breathability, and resistance to UV degradation. With proper care, a high-quality bag can last for multiple growing seasons, offering excellent value for the investment. For the environmentally conscious gardener, the benefits are even more pronounced. At the end of their lifespan, these bags are easily cleaned, dried, and stored in a small space for the next year, eliminating the waste associated with single-use plastic pots. When the fabric does eventually wear out, it is often recyclable, and the material itself can be repurposed for numerous other household and garden tasks, minimizing its environmental footprint.

Choosing the Right Bag and Optimizing Your Setup
To harness the full potential of garden grow bags, selecting the correct size and preparing the right growing medium is essential. The diameter of the bag will dictate what you can grow, with larger容积 bags being necessary for fruit-bearing plants like tomatoes, peppers, and zucchini. Conversely, smaller bags are perfectly suited for herbs, salad greens, or flowers. Success is not just about the bag itself, but about the ecosystem you create within it. A high-quality, nutrient-rich potting mix is crucial, as it provides the necessary structure and food for your plants, working in tandem with the bag's unique properties to foster robust growth.
A Practical Comparison Guide
Understanding the specific benefits of different bag sizes can help you make informed choices for your garden.
| Bag Diameter | Common Plants | Key Benefit |
|---|---|---|
| 10-12 inches | Herbs (basil, parsley), Lettuce, Radishes | Space-efficient for small, fast-growing crops |
| 14-16 inches | Cherry tomatoes, Peppers, Dwarf varieties | Ideal balance for most vegetables and flowering plants |
| 18+ inches | Tomatoes (indeterminate), Squash, Cucumbers | Provides ample room for deep root systems and large foliage |
